Knee Pain

Acupunc­ture helps in the recov­ery from knee pain and range of motion issues asso­ci­ated with dam­age to struc­tures such as the ACL, MCL and menis­cus. Post-surgical acupunc­ture is also help­ful in assur­ance of a com­plete and rapid recu­per­a­tion process. Research has tested this ancient sci­ence. Dr. Stephen Straus, direc­tor of the National Cen­ter for Com­ple­men­tary and Alter­na­tive Med­i­cine notes, “acupunc­ture reduces the pain and func­tional impair­ment of osteoarthri­tis of the knee.”

The process involves local stim­u­la­tion of the dam­aged region to engage and enhance the recov­ery process. Acupunc­ture reduces pain but also restores func­tion to the knee. As a result of acupunc­ture care, the knee is less likely to incur fur­ther dam­age and the acupunc­ture halts irri­ta­tion that can lead to arthri­tis formation.
